Form 4: H&E Equipment Services Executive Chairman Finalizes Share Holdings Post-Merger with Herc Holdings
Insider Transaction Report
John Engquist, Executive Chairman of H&E Equipment Services, Inc., reported the final disposition of his common stock holdings following the company's acquisition by Herc Holdings Inc.
Summary
- John Engquist, the Executive Chairman of the Board and a Director of H&E Equipment Services, Inc. (HEES), filed a Form 4 detailing changes in his beneficial ownership of company stock.
- On May 27, 2025, Mr. Engquist acquired 28,372 shares of common stock at a price of $0, stemming from the accelerated vesting of his 2023 and 2024 Performance Awards (PSUs) under the company's 2016 Stock-Based Incentive Compensation Plan.
- Also on May 27, 2025, he disposed of 23,103 shares at a price of $95.46 to satisfy tax liabilities related to the accelerated vesting of these PSUs and other restricted stock awards.
- On June 2, 2025, Mr. Engquist disposed of his remaining 2,503,319 shares of H&E common stock due to the consummation of the merger with Herc Holdings Inc. (Parent) and its subsidiary, HR Merger Sub Inc.
- Under the merger agreement, dated February 19, 2025, each share of H&E common stock was exchanged for $78.75 in cash and 0.1287 shares of Herc Holdings Inc. common stock, without interest and less any applicable withholding taxes.
- The acquisition officially closed on June 2, 2025, resulting in Mr. Engquist holding 0 shares of H&E Equipment Services, Inc. common stock.

Industry Context
This filing reflects a significant consolidation event within the equipment rental industry, where H&E Equipment Services, a major player, has been acquired by Herc Holdings Inc., another prominent industry participant. Such mergers typically aim to achieve economies of scale, expand market reach, and enhance competitive positioning in a capital-intensive sector.
